Which country made Jacobs Krönung coffee?

Jacobs is Germany’s most popular coffee brand, and the green Krönung package with its characteristic crown has been a well-known and treasured sight on German coffee tables for decades. Jacobs can trace its history back to 1895, when the company was founded in Bremen by Johann Jacobs. Imported from Germany, Jacobs Kronung premium ground coffee has a rich aroma and a refined flavor. Is Jacobs coffee a German brand?

Our founder Johann Jacobs opens his first store in the bustling harbour city of Bremen, Germany. Stocking coffee, tea, chocolate and biscuits, he declares it his mission to “deliver only the best, impeccable goods at reasonable prices. Jacobs is Germany’s most popular coffee brand, and the famous Jacobs crown is a well-known sight on German coffee tables. Jacobs can trace its history back to 1895, when the company was founded in Bremen by Johann Jacobs. Jacobs has been part of the Dutch Jacobs Douwe Egbert Group since 2015.

Which Jacobs coffee is the best?

JACOBS KRÖNUNG We didn’t call it ‘the crowning’ for no reason. Celebrated since 1966, Jacobs Krönung is our signature blend. Known for that irresistable aroma that has been making people’s mornings special for over 50 years. This classic roasted coffee is just right for lovers of balanced and aromatic coffee. Jacobs Krönung (marketed as Jacobs Monarch in some markets) and available in disks for the Tassimo coffee maker.
